Output 99521033a6650ee4df8d136e1209ec8f8869bfc44e8811c814e2c26c5be56e0b:4

value
8017200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a59c6111215a3d8421fa8d57244a8e9d4a294de9 OP_EQUAL
address
3GngkcP4kd8utcu14czeXj4t5zxyGgcQhV
transaction
99521033a6650ee4df8d136e1209ec8f8869bfc44e8811c814e2c26c5be56e0b
spent
true